Four Roses, a historic bourbon distillery in Lawrenceburg, Kentucky, has gained nationwide recognition for its quality whiskey offerings since its revival in the 21st century. The distillery's range includes the 80 proof Yellow Label and higher proof options like the Small Batch at 90 proof and Single Barrel at 100 proof. The Small Batch Select, launched in 2019, is particularly sought after, with limited editions vanishing quickly from shelves. Whiskey enthusiasts are divided on the Yellow Label, some considering it a competitive mixer while others believe it increasingly lacks value as prices rise.
While the standard bottle of Four Roses comes through at 80 proof, the Small Batch is 90 proof, likely due to its slightly older age.
However, as the price has crept up, some experienced whiskey sippers feel it's outgrowing its britches, and that you're better off proceeding up to Small Batch.
